Hang Zeng is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Molecular Biology and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Hang Zeng has authored 50 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Pharmacology, 14 papers in Molecular Biology and 12 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Hang Zeng’s work include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(11 papers), Mechanisms of Drug-Induced Hepatotoxicity (11 papers) and Pharmacogenetics and Drug Metabolism (9 papers). Hang Zeng is often cited by papers focused on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(11 papers), Mechanisms of Drug-Induced Hepatotoxicity (11 papers) and Pharmacogenetics and Drug Metabolism (9 papers). Hang Zeng coll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Belgium. Hang Zeng's co-authors include Min Huang, Huichang Bi, Xiaomei Fan, Yiming Jiang and Pan Chen and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Environmental Science & Technology and Analytical Chemistry.
